The Importance of Organic Dog Treats

Organic dog treats are made without artificial pesticides, fertilizers, and additives, making them a healthier option for your pet. 1. Read the Ingredients List

The first step is always to check the ingredients. The best organic dog treats have simple, recognizable ingredients. We opt for treats with organic proteins as the main ingredient, supplemented by organic fruits and vegetables.

2. Look for Certifications

It's essential to look for treats that are certified organic by reputable organizations. This certification ensures that the products meet stringent organic standards, which is something we don’t compromise on.

Buddy’s Top Picks for the Best Organic Dog Treats

Organic Chicken Jerky

This high-protein treat is a staple in our home. It’s made from free-range chicken that’s organically fed and contains no added hormones or antibiotics. Buddy loves the chewy texture, and I love the nutritional benefits it offers.

Organic Pumpkin Biscuits

These are great for Buddy's digestion, thanks to the fiber content in pumpkin. They’re also perfect for his dental health, as the hard texture helps clean his teeth as he chews.

Organic Sweet Potato Chews

Sweet potatoes are a fantastic source of vitamins B6 and C, fiber, and beta-carotene. These chews are not only tasty but also help maintain healthy skin and coat for Buddy.

Safe Valentine's Day treats for dogs use dog-friendly ingredients like xylitol-free peanut butter, oat flour, banana, and carob. Chocolate, xylitol, raisins, and macadamia nuts are toxic to dogs and should never be shared. Yes, trachea chews are safe for most dogs when sized correctly and supervised. Made from a single ingredient — beef cartilage — they're a natural source of glucosamine and chondroitin that support joint and dental health. They are not rawhide and are fully digestible.
